Reviewed by Mike Rimmer
Jonny Baker and Jon Birch, whose unique partnership has delivered some of the most intriguing and creative Christian music in the UK over the last decade, unveil a set of worship songs that strongly fit into the alternative worship genre. Baker's book on the subject is an illuminating introduction into what can be achieved outside of hymns or Matt Redman. This album simply shows the duo practising what they preach with a collection of fellow travellers. Andy Thornton and Doug Gay contribute songs and all of it is wrapped up in Jon Birch's trademark ambient soundscapes and rhythms. Songs like "Save My Life" and "I'm Thirsty Again" drift by with their own intrinsic beauty. What I love about this is that the songs are very spacious allowing the listener to get past the words being sung into a deeper place of interacting with God. Emotionally, the songs are rooted in a psalm-like reality where all of life crunches together and the good bits and the struggles are celebrated in equal measure. Yet another excellent offering from the Proost collective.
